Memory access callback function type. A function pointer data type. This represents a function that can be used to access (read or write) memory described in the memory maps. The parameters for this type of function are: dest_p Pointer to destination of the memory read or write. source_p Pointer to source of the memory read or write. nbytes Number of bytes to read or write. context_p Pointer to generic context. bytes_moved_p Pointer to location to return number of bytes moved. The function returns dest_p if no error occurs during the memory access. If an error does occur, though, then the function returns NULL. |

Add an entry to the memory map table. Add an entry to the memory map table, which defines all the valid locations within the memory address space. Each table entry defines a contiguous region of the memory address space, including the types of accesses allowed to the region and pointers to callback functions that can be used to read and write the region.

Byte-swapped 32-bit memory read callback. This is a callback function for reading 32-bit words that require byte swapping. Accesses must be a multiple of 32-bits and aligned on a 32-bit boundary.

Buffer read access. This is a callback function for reading values from a buffer. This would be used, for example, to read a snapshot of the CPU register values or the PCI configuration space values which have been captured in a buffer. A pointer to the beginning of this snapshot buffer must be provided as the buf_p parameter.

Generic memory access callback. This is a callback function for reading and writing generic memory. It is suitable for RAM or other memory that has no alignment or access restrictions.

Byte-swapped 32-bit memory write callback. This is a callback function for writing 32-bit words that require byte swapping. Accesses must be a multiple of 32-bits and aligned on a 32-bit boundary.

Buffer write access. This is a callback function for writing values to a buffer. A pointer to the beginning of the buffer must be provided as the buf_p parameter.
